Re: On IRC logs, expectation of privacy, and posting



This makes good sense, but I suggest that it might be wise to adopt a
convention of naming the channel where a logged discussion is to take
place something like "#foo-logged" so that no one will claim surprise.  
In practice, since people will join and leave during the course of any
discussion, it will be impossible to solicit consent from each.
